WHAT IS A DTS?
The Discipleship Training School (DTS) is an intensive 24/7 (24 hours, 7 days a week) Christian training course carried over 6 months. Three months (11-12 weeks) are spent in lectures/training at the YWAM base (the one I will be at will be in Newcastle, though there are bases ALL OVER THE WORLD!!!) and three months are spent over seas, putting what was learnt in the classroom, into a practical field assignment, as part of the ultimate assignment (Matthew 28:19 "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it").


WHAT IS THE PURPOSE OF A DTS?
(Note: Copied and pasted from source mentioned at the bottom)
The purpose of a DTS is:

1. To GATHER and CHALLENGE people to worship, to listen to and obey God, releasing
them (in the context of the DTS) to serve through evangelism, intercession, acts of
compassion and other expressions of God's heart for the world, possibly even pioneering
new ministries.

2. To INSPIRE and CULTIVATE growth in one's relationship with God resulting in Christ like character, which is based on a solid Biblical foundation, the work of the Holy Spirit and the
personal application of Biblical truth, especially concerning God's Character, the Cross
and empowering Grace.

3. To SHARPEN one's ability to relate to, learn from and work with people, including those of
different cultures, personalities and perspectives.

4. To further EQUIP each one to serve God's purposes either in or outside of YWAM Family
of Ministries, strengthening a commitment to reach the lost, especially the unreached, to
care for the poor, and to influence all areas of society.

5. To IMPART the vision and foundational values of Youth With A Mission International as
well as that of the host operating location and to provide information regarding a variety of
opportunities for service.


WHAT ARE THE GRADUATE AIMS OF A DTS?
  • With a growing understanding of the breadth and depth of God’s character and ways
  • Who are becoming more like Jesus in the way they relate to God and people
  • Who increasingly cooperate with the empowering presence of the indwelling Holy Spirit
  • Who listen to and obey God as the result of God’s enabling Grace
  • Who search the Scripture in such a way that transforms beliefs, values and behaviours
  • With strengthened lifestyles of worship, intercession and spiritual warfare
  • With a greater ability to work with others, especially those different to themselves
  • Who can share the Gospel with the lost and have a life long commitment to do so
  • With a commitment to continue to be involved in some way with God’s work among the
    nations, including unreached people, the poor and needy and in spheres of society
  • Who understand the calling and values of YWAM and are aware of a variety of
    opportunities available to them throughout YWAM
  • With a clearer understanding of God’s purposes for their life and a sense of their life
    direction
  • Who either:
    1. Go on to serve God in either a context familiar or foreign to them
    2. Pursue further training (in or outside of YWAM) to equip them for further service.
WHAT ARE THE DTS COURSE OUTCOMES?
In short, the DTS course outcomes are as follows:
  • To encounter God
  • To see all of life from God's perspective
  • To recognise Jesus as Lord
  • To become more like Jesus
  • To do the works of Jesus
  • To orientate to YWAM
HOW IS THE TRAINING DELIVERED?
Training is delivered in a variety of ways, some of which are as follows:
  • Classroom lectures
  • Guided group discussions
  • Research projects
  • field training (local and overseas ministry and outreach)
  • Intercession
  • Prayer
  • Worship
  • Bible studies
  • Morning devotions
  • Individual mentoring times
  • General housekeeping responsibilities
  • Personal Studies, etc.
WHO ARE THE TEACHERS?
The teachers can be anyone from resident staff, to local pastors and ministers, to people (lecturers) visiting from different parts of the world! The visiting lecturers are experienced in their field of ministry and willing to share :) There are also leaders for the DTS, which I will do a post to introduce you to them, so you can also share the experience with me.
